The fuel injection rail is a vital piece of the engine's fuel system, responsible for delivering fuel from the fuel tank to the engine's cylinders at precisely the right time and pressure. This precise control of fuel delivery is crucial for efficient combustion, which in turn improves the engine's power output and fuel efficiency.
